The photo features a dragon parade in Changsha, circa 1916, and shows the Hsiang-ya Hospital in the background. The photo is a reproduction from the personal collection of Nina Gage, who headed the Yale-China Association's (then Yale-in-China) nursing education and care program at the Hsiang-ya School of Nursing from 1909-1926. Nursing was recognized as a special priority for the Yale-China Association's early health work in Hunan province as nursing had no professional precedents in Chinese society at that time. Today, Yale-China has many programs in the area of public health and nursing and continues to work closely with Hsiang-ya (now Xiangya).
